I've been running my new native campaign on Taboola for a little over a week now. Throughout the whole time there has been a site which is the best performing for me by far and gives me the second-highest volume. However I just checked today's stats and I have had 0 visits and 0 impressions from this site today. I didn't block it and I didn't change any settings that would effect it. I checked my tracker and it seems all the traffic from that site suddenly stopped last night and I haven't gotten any since. My bid is already very high for this particular site (45% above my avg bid) so I'm stumped as to why traffic from it stopped all of a sudden. Has anyone else faced this sort of thing before? Can you spy manually and see if their Taboola widget is still up? Or is it in another geo? Sometimes sites will switch back and forth between ad networks, so they might have their Taboola ads off right now.
Could also be SmartBid if you are using it... it seems to do all sorts of weird stuff...
Or, I doubt this is it, but I believe some networks allow sites to 'blacklist' ad accounts, so if they didn't like your headline or image they could have blocked you, though I doubt that is it.
If it was Revcontent where the widgets are finite in size I might suspect you're just getting outbid, but Taboola is typically infinite-scroll so usually you get at least *some* clicks even if your bid is low.
